Ratzinger's Personhood Debate

This chapter explores Ratzinger's interpretation of personhood, emphasizing relationality over traditional metaphysical categories. It critiques the limitations of Thomistic thought and examines the complexities of divine relationality, particularly within the Trinity. The discussion highlights the philosophical implications of substance and existence in understanding personal identity and interrelation.
